Logging Off Getting Started The Log off option on the menu enables you to close all active applications. A message box will be displayed asking you to confirm the action. Rebooting the System The Reboot option on the menu enables you to make the thin client operating system shut down then restart. Note that all active connections will be closed. A message box will be displayed asking you to confirm the action. Shutting Down Your Thin Client The Shutdown option on the menu enables you to shutdown your thin client.
